r/LangGraph is a subreddit with 4k members. The most common kinds of discussions are ideas and advice requests, and the community frequently discusses langgraph, agent, multi agent, ai, and workflow.
LangGraph is a library for building stateful, multi-actor applications with LLMs, used to create agent and multi-agent workflows. The documentation can be found at https://langchain-ai.github.io/langgraph/
